【问题标题】:mogrify makes filesize of image about 3 times larger, when image is reduced当图像缩小时,mogrify 使图像的文件大小大约大 3 倍
【发布时间】:2013-01-06 16:40:54
【问题描述】:

我有一些 png 图片:

0.png   -  665.3 kB  -   1589 x 2175
1.png   -  989.9 kB  -   1589 x 2175
2.png   -  138.7 kB  -   1589 x 2175
3.png   -  351.9 kB  -   1589 x 2175

我想让图像的高度为 2000(更小),所以我给出了这个命令:

mogrify -resize x2000 *

新的图像大小完美但文件大小增加了 3 倍以上

0.png   -    1.8 MB  -   1461 x 2000
1.png   -    1.4 MB  -   1461 x 2000
2.png   -  666.3 kB  -   1461 x 2000
3.png   -  971.9 kB  -   1461 x 2000

我该怎么做才能保持合理的尺寸?

P.S.:尝试使用 Gimp 调整图像大小,0.png 达到 3.4 MB!!!发生了什么?

【问题讨论】:

  • 这应该会有所帮助:askubuntu.com/questions/25356/…
  • 大小从 1.849.803 减少了 600 字节到 1.849.210
  • 很难说没有看到你的 .png。我无法使用 mogrify 复制这种大小增加。如果您使用转换,您会得到相同的结果吗?如果你使用-quality怎么样?

标签: imagemagick mogrify


【解决方案1】:

您的输出 PNG 中的每个样本可能有 16 位。使用“-depth 8”选项来防止:

mogrify -resize x2000 -depth 8 *.png

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2020-01-25
    • 2017-10-14
    • 2014-10-29
    • 1970-01-01
    • 1970-01-01
    • 2013-09-11
    相关资源
    最近更新 更多